Omaha Offensive Stats & Trends:

Omaha averaged 39% free throw attempts for every field goal attempt (696 free throw attempts/1,768 field goal attempts) last season — highest among Summit Teams; League Avg: 31%

Omaha averaged 9.5 turnovers per game (294 turnovers/31 games) last season — tied for 17th best among Division 1 Teams; League Avg: 11.6

Omaha has averaged 8.0 offensive rebounds per game (185 rebounds/23 games) this season — tied for 16th lowest among Division 1 Teams; League Avg: 10.6

Omaha made 6.0 three-pointers per game last season — tied for 35th lowest among Division 1 Teams; League Avg: 7.5

Denver Offensive Stats & Trends:

Denver averaged 80.9 points per game (2,589 points/32 games) last season — best among Summit Teams; League Avg: 75.1

Denver has averaged 83.4 points per game (1,918 points/23 games) this season — best among Summit Teams; League Avg: 78.0

Denver has averaged 1.37 points per shot (1,918 points/1,396 shots) this season — tied for 30th best among Division 1 Teams; League Avg: 1.29

Denver had 23.2 free throw attempts per game last season — tied for 20th best among Division 1 Teams; League Avg: 19.2

Omaha Defensive Stats & Trends:

Omaha allowed opponents to shoot 36% from three (270/753) last season — 20th highest among Division 1 Teams; League Avg: 34%

Omaha has allowed an average of 1.27 points per shot (1,738 points/1,367 shots) this season — 4th best among Summit Teams ; League Avg: 1.30

Omaha has allowed opponents to shoot 44% (603/1,367) this season — 3rd best among Summit Teams ; League Avg: 46%

Omaha has allowed 8.8 made three-pointers per game since the start of the 2023-24 season — tied for 10th highest among Division 1 Teams; League Avg: 7.6

Denver Defensive Stats & Trends:

Denver has allowed an average of 1.41 points per shot (4,420 points/3,135 shots) since the start of the 2024-25 season — tied for highest among Division 1 Teams; League Avg: 1.25

Denver has allowed 84.2 points per game (1,937 points/23 games) this season — 7th highest among Division 1 Teams; League Avg: 74.1

Denver has allowed an average of 1.36 points per shot (6,989 points/5,149 shots) since the start of the 2023-24 season — 2nd highest among Division 1 Teams; League Avg: 1.25

Denver has allowed opponents to shoot 48% (2,451/5,149) since the start of the 2023-24 season — 4th highest among Division 1 Teams; League Avg: 44%
